•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

makroda and kullanımı

  • Konbuyu başlatan Konbuyu başlatan snx111
  • Başlangıç tarihi Başlangıç tarihi

snx111

Banned
Katılım
10 Ağustos 2010
Mesajlar
789
Excel Vers. ve Dili
2010 office tr
sub saybak()
If Range("AA2").Value > Range("ab2").Value And Range("ac2").Value And Range("ad2").Value Then Top = "toplam gol 0-1"

range("a1")= top
end sub

yazdıgımda hata vermiyor ama makro çalışmıyor tek and kullandıgımda çalışıyor . bi komut satırında and baglacını 1 keremi kullanmak gerekir ?
 
And lerinizi ayrıştırırsak;
"Range("AA2").Value > Range("ab2").Value" : Sınama var. Doğru
"Range("ac2").Value", "Range("ad2").Value" : Sınama yok. Hangi hücre/değer ile hangi kritere göre karşılaştırdığınız belli değil, mesela bu hücreleri yine Range("AA2") hücresi ile büyüklük karşılaştırması yapacaksanız. kodları aşağıdaki gibi değiştirmeniz gerekir.
sub saybak()
If Range("AA2").Value > Range("ab2").Value And Range("AA2").Value > Range("ac2").Value And Range("AA2").Value > Range("ad2").Value Then Top = "toplam gol 0-1"

range("a1")= top
end sub
 
Son düzenleme:
Geri
Üst